Water Heater Maintenance offers a preventative plumbing service that includes cleaning the tank, evaluating parts, and adjusting settings. Regular maintenance extends the lifespan of both tank and tankless units, minimizes utility use and prevents costly failures. This service is recommended annually for optimal performance
